I did mention the bi-directional contour on the Rukus the other day, but my slightly angled spine shot didn't show it that well. This one's more directly overhead and gives a bit better view. It's not as pronounced as the same feature on my TRM Machine Flipper, but is definitely noticeable in hand and really serves to lock the grip in along with its vertical countering and profile. Dang, that's cool to see baby hawks, that's something you don't see very often! I often have a hawk flying way above my house, just thermaling around. My crow friends absolutely hate them though. They're mortal enemies haha. Anytime there's a hawk above my place, there are 3 or 4 crows chasing it around trying to get it out of there. Sometimes the hawk will perch up on a tree limb and the crows will take turns, one by one, swooping down full speed and just missing him, or sometimes I think barely nicking him. It's a warzone sometimes.

No you don't see it often. Crows and owls are also mortal enemies as well. If you notice, crows are like wolves and coyotes. They rarely attack alone. Always multiples. Alone, the hawk would easily win. With more than one to watch for, might not be the same outcome.
